Amorphous versus Nanocrystalline Structure of Sputtered Tungsten Carbon Thin Film
The structure of tungsten carbide thin films (prepared by magnetron sputtering deposition) was found to be apparently amorphous following the observed typical diffuse XRD patterns[1]. In contrast, this extended EM&D investigation discloses its prominent crystalline feature in a form of dense compact aggregate of randomly oriented nanocrystals of rather globular shape and uniform size (D≈ 2-3nm).
